Petronet LNG Limited engages in the import, storage, regasification, and supply of liquefied natural gas (LNG) in India. It owns and operates an LNG import and regasification terminal with name plate capacity of 17.5 MMTPA located in Dahej, Gujarat; and an LNG terminal with name plate capacity of 5 MMTPA located in Kochi, Kerala. The company serves private entities, key infrastructure entities, petrochemical entities, city gas distribution entities, refineries, fertilizer and power generating entities, and other industrial entities.
